Background
As an international cooperation enterprise for sustainable development with worldwide operations, the federally owned Deutsche Gesellschaft für Internationale Zusammenarbeit (GIZ) GmbH supports the German Government in achieving its development-policy objectives; and in Ethiopia, GIZ has been working for more than 40 years in bilateral cooperation on behalf of the German Federal Ministry for Economic Cooperation and Development (BMZ) and on commission of the Ethiopian government and international donors.
The Strengthening Drought Resilience (SDR) support Programme of GIZ was initiated in 2013 as a response to the Ethiopian Government’s appeal to end drought emergencies. Thus, SDR Program is closely linked to the Country Programming Paper (CPP) to End Drought Emergencies in the Horn of Africa and anchored in the over-arching Growth and Transformation Plan (GTP). This programme is implemented under the Ethiopian Ministry of Agriculture and Livestock Resources (MoALR), the respective decentralised bureaus and the GIZ.
The SDR-Programme of GIZ supports the Ethiopian government’s endeavours to strengthen the drought resilience capacity of pastoralists and agro-pastoralists in selected pilot areas in Afar and Somali regions, by allowing them to adapt their livelihood system to a changing natural and socio-economic environment context in order to get a higher and more secured income.
